Your new company Hays Education is seeking an experienced and enthusiastic Year 5 Supply Teacher to join a welcoming primary school in Widnes for the remainder of the academic year. This is an excellent opportunity for a confident practitioner who can quickly build rapport, deliver high-quality teaching, and maintain a positive learning environment.

Your new role:

  • Deliver engaging and well-structured lessons to a Year 5 class
  • Follow the school's curriculum and behaviour policies
  • Assess pupil progress and provide constructive feedback
  • Maintain a safe, inclusive, and supportive classroom environment
  • Work collaboratively with school staff and leadership

What you'll need to succeed:

  • Qualified Teacher Status (QTS)
  • Recent experience teaching KS2, ideally Year 5
  • Strong classroom management and communication skills
  • Flexibility, reliability, and a proactive approach

How to prepare for a job interview at Hays Specialist Recruitment Limited

✨Know Your Curriculum

Familiarise yourself with the school's curriculum and behaviour policies. Be ready to discuss how you would implement these in your lessons, as this shows you’re proactive and aligned with their teaching approach.

✨Showcase Your Classroom Management Skills

Prepare examples of how you've successfully managed a classroom in the past. Highlight specific strategies you’ve used to maintain a positive learning environment, as strong classroom management is key for a Year 5 teacher.

✨Engage with the Interviewers

Build rapport with your interviewers by being personable and enthusiastic. Ask them questions about the school culture and how they support their teachers, which demonstrates your interest in being part of their team.

✨Reflect on Your Teaching Experience

Be ready to discuss your recent experience teaching KS2, particularly Year 5. Share specific examples of lessons you've delivered, how you assessed pupil progress, and the feedback you provided, showcasing your reflective practice.
